Historical Paint Techniques & Materials
Professional restoration shop auto paint requires mastery of historical paint systems spanning decades of automotive evolution. Single-stage lacquers from the 1930s-50s demand different techniques than acrylic enamels from the 1960s-70s, while modern base coat/clear coat systems require specialized knowledge for period-correct application.
Era-Specific Paint Systems
Different automotive eras used distinct paint technologies requiring specialized restoration techniques. Pre-war vehicles often featured cellulose lacquers, post-war classics used alkyd enamels, while muscle car era vehicles introduced acrylic systems.
